Also, use a relay to send power to the pump from the ignition. 10 gauge from battery, 10 gauge to the pump, purple wire from ignition, 10 guage ground. I use a pressure switch to ground the relay.

Also, you need to use the same size hose or bigger (preferably) for the return line.

We ran into this same issue at the beginning of the year with brand new apex fuel pumps and the KE upgrade. 5psi at idle and would never recover. switched back to the carter pumps and KE upgrades. back to 9PSI at idle and never drops below 7psi. 509ci- 675hp

Sorry guys been away working on the boat....so what I did is replaced this pump with a quickfuel 30-175qft...it is an electric pump with the regulator built in that can be run in bypass or dead head mode...I ran it in dead head mode with no return set to 8 psi and it doesn't fluctuate at all off of 8 psi..very nice pump

I would eventually bypass it to the filter head. I ran my Mallory 140's dead headed for 10 years with no issues,just a brush rebuild here and there. I bypassed them a few years ago and it is just easier on the pump and lower amp draw.
